The Kimsuky group’s activities in October 2023 decreased slightly in comparison to their overall activities in September. One phishing domain was discovered, but because it uses the BabyShark infrastructure, it was classified as the BabyShark type. There was also a compound type where FlowerPower and RandomQuery were distributed simultaneously. Finally, more changes to the FlowerPower system via script fragmentation were observed.



2023_Oct_Threat Trend Report on Kimsuky Group
